The Minster for Transport has said we need to take collective responsibility if we are going to reverse the number of deaths on our roads.

Shane Ross is launching a new campaign to support European Day Without A Road Death, next Wednesday, September 21.

Project Edward is a joint initiative of police and road safety authorities across Europe.

Garda Commissioner Noirin O’Sullivan is urging all road users here to play a part in reducing road deaths: “Statistics can sometimes benign what it means in a human aspect.

“26,000 road deaths right across Europe last year and indeed to think of 70 people a day losing their lives on roads right across Europe.

“Sometimes we can take comfort in the fact that Ireland is the 5th lowest, but that doesn’t really account for people who are bereaved or seriously hurt.”
